Output 24632be1c9dda3f72b5e4dd1b31491864eb91d6ca31cfc65010bbf031078e694:1

value
20677018
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3980c5cb917407729399f1862291292855f5ea4 OP_EQUALVERIFY OP_CHECKSIG
address
1PD1M7gTfBUuYG94SzqmoadyGwbyLFjx4u
transaction
24632be1c9dda3f72b5e4dd1b31491864eb91d6ca31cfc65010bbf031078e694
spent
true